By Type
208V
The 208V segment is widely used in small and medium commercial kitchens due to its easy installation and moderate power use. Around 46% of small restaurants prefer 208V electric ranges as they consume less energy and support basic cooking needs. Nearly 49% of cafes and quick food outlets use this type for daily operations. It is also preferred by 41% of urban kitchens where space and power supply are limited.
208V type held the largest share in the Commercial Electric Restaurant Ranges Market, accounting for USD 20.71 Billion in 2025, representing 46% of the total market. This segment is expected to grow at a CAGR of 5.32% from 2025 to 2035, driven by cost efficiency and ease of use.
240V
The 240V segment is popular among mid-size restaurants due to its balanced performance and efficiency. Around 38% of restaurants use 240V ranges for better heating capacity and faster cooking. Nearly 44% of food service operators report improved cooking speed with this type. It is also used by 36% of cloud kitchens for handling moderate cooking loads efficiently.
240V type held a significant share in the Commercial Electric Restaurant Ranges Market, accounting for USD 15.76 Billion in 2025, representing 35% of the total market. This segment is expected to grow at a CAGR of 5.61% from 2025 to 2035, supported by its balanced performance.
480V
The 480V segment is mainly used in large commercial kitchens and hotels where high power output is required. Around 32% of large-scale kitchens prefer this type for heavy-duty cooking. Nearly 29% of hotel kitchens use 480V ranges to manage high-volume food preparation. It is also used by 27% of industrial kitchens due to its strong performance and faster heating.
480V type accounted for USD 8.56 Billion in 2025 in the Commercial Electric Restaurant Ranges Market, representing 19% of the total market. This segment is expected to grow at a CAGR of 5.78% from 2025 to 2035, driven by demand from large-scale operations.
By Application
Quick Service Restaurants
Quick service restaurants hold a major share due to fast cooking requirements and high customer turnover. Around 58% of quick service outlets rely on electric ranges for consistent cooking. Nearly 52% of these outlets prefer electric systems for easy operation and lower maintenance. About 47% report improved efficiency after switching to electric equipment.
Quick Service Restaurants held the largest share in the Commercial Electric Restaurant Ranges Market, accounting for USD 21.16 Billion in 2025, representing 47% of the total market. This segment is expected to grow at a CAGR of 5.69% from 2025 to 2035, driven by rising demand for fast food services.
Full-Service Restaurants
Full-service restaurants use electric ranges for better temperature control and food quality. Around 44% of such restaurants prefer electric cooking equipment for consistent output. Nearly 39% report improved kitchen safety with electric ranges. About 42% of chefs prefer electric ranges for precision cooking.
Full-Service Restaurants accounted for USD 13.96 Billion in 2025, representing 31% of the total market. This segment is expected to grow at a CAGR of 5.48% from 2025 to 2035, supported by demand for quality dining experiences.
Hotels
Hotels use electric restaurant ranges for bulk cooking and safety standards. Around 36% of hotel kitchens prefer electric systems for better energy management. Nearly 33% of hotels use advanced electric ranges with automation features. About 31% report reduced heat generation in kitchens.
Hotels accounted for USD 6.75 Billion in 2025, representing 15% of the total market. This segment is expected to grow at a CAGR of 5.52% from 2025 to 2035, driven by growth in the hospitality sector.
Other Food Services
Other food services include catering, canteens, and institutional kitchens. Around 29% of these services use electric ranges for ease of use and safety. Nearly 27% report cost savings in operations. About 25% prefer electric ranges due to simple maintenance and installation.
Other Food Services accounted for USD 3.15 Billion in 2025, representing 7% of the total market. This segment is expected to grow at a CAGR of 5.21% from 2025 to 2035, supported by growing institutional demand.
